We are committed to serving the community and treat our patients as family.As an RN Case Manager, you will work collaboratively with inter-professional teams across the continuum of care to facilitate and ensure effective transitional care. The core values of patient advocacy, holistic assessment, care planning and the empowerment of patients and families are essential to this role. Ensure compliance with standards of the accrediting bodies, state mandated revised code and the CMS Conditions of Participation.
Promote interprofessional synchronization throughout the acute episode.
Complete effective handoffs to the next level of care or community to ensure continuity of care.
Proactively assess, identify and work to mitigate the risk posed by barriers to transitions of care.
Work with the patient and/or care partner(s) to develop a comprehensive, individualized transitional care plan.
Participate and lead in patient rounding activities, huddles and committee meetings.
Minimum qualifications for the ideal future caregiver include:
Graduate from an accredited school of Professional Nursing
Current state licensure as a Registered Nurse (RN)
Basic Life Support (BLS) Certification through the American Heart Association (AHA)
Three years of recent RN clinical experience
Preferred qualifications for the ideal future caregiver include:
Bachelor's of Science in Nursing (BSN)
CTM, ACM or CCM Certification within one year of eligibility
Two years of recent experience in utilization review, quality or care management
Knowledge of acute care and accreditation requirements.
Experience in discharge planning and quality improvement
